Production workflow controls

Use these controls when a workflow needs to stay stable after launch, not just pass a happy-path test.

01

Retry failed API calls

Automatically retry temporary failures before a run is marked as failed.

02

Handle 429 / rate-limit responses

Pause, back off, and continue the workflow safely when an upstream API throttles requests.

03

Add fallback branches for missing fields

Route incomplete payloads into a safe branch instead of letting the main scenario break.

04

Prevent duplicates with lookup-before-create logic

Check whether a record already exists before creating a new one in the destination system.

05

Use JavaScript to normalize dates, phone numbers, tags, and statuses

Clean and standardize values before mapping them into downstream fields.

06

Store execution logs for debugging

Keep a trace of what happened in every run so production issues are easier to inspect.

07

Route failed runs to email or a database

Notify the team or save failures for follow-up when a run cannot complete successfully.

08

Manually rerun failed executions

Replay a failed run after the issue is fixed without rebuilding the scenario from scratch.

About Blink

Blink is a home security and smart home system that offers wireless HD cameras, video doorbells, and outdoor floodlight cameras with motion detection, two-way audio, and cloud storage. The platform lets you monitor your home in real-time, receive alerts when motion is detected, and review recorded clips through the Blink mobile app. Blink devices run on AA batteries for up to two years and connect to your home Wi-Fi without requiring professional installation or monthly fees for basic local storage via the Sync Module.

Zoom is a leading video communications platform that enables seamless virtual meetings, webinars, and conference calls. With features like high-definition video and audio, screen sharing, chat functionality, and breakout rooms, Zoom facilitates effective collaboration and engagement for teams of all sizes. Its cloud-based infrastructure ensures reliable connectivity, while features like virtual backgrounds and meeting recordings enhance the user experience, making it an essential tool for remote work and online events.
